TTFLast Saturday 9 volunteers showed up to work with Cobh Tidy Towns. We swept and cleared months of silt and leaves from the roadside and footpaths on then Rushbrooke approach to Cobh. 12 bags of marine debris was cleaned from under the boats and trailers by Kennedy pier. 2 bags of cans and bottles were picked from the Burma steps. We also swept the steps from top to bottom as there was a shocking amount of smashed glass littering the steps.

An ongoing problem in this area which is a hazard and an unnecessary eyesore. Thanks to the generosity of Harbour Browns for inviting us in for freshly baked scones and coffee after our busy morning.
